In conclusion, Wrike and GameMaker: Studio serve distinct purposes in the realm of project management and game development, respectively. Wrike excels in facilitating collaboration and organization for teams across various industries, offering robust tools for task management and workflow optimization. In contrast, GameMaker: Studio provides an accessible platform for aspiring game developers to create and publish games with ease. Ultimately, the choice between the two depends on whether the focus is on project management or game creation.
